Overview

The Panasonic Lumix GX9 (DC-GX9MK) is a mirrorless camera designed for advanced photographers who desire a compact and versatile shooting tool. It features a 20.3-megapixel Micro Four Thirds MOS sensor combined with a powerful Venus Engine image processor, enabling high-resolution image quality and fast processing speeds.

The camera offers a 5-axis dual image stabilization system that compensates for camera shake during handheld shooting, improving image sharpness and video stability significantly.

The GX9 delivers 4K UHD video recording at 30fps, allowing high-definition video capture with excellent detail and color fidelity.

Its electronic viewfinder (EVF) provides a 2.76-million dot OLED display, enhanced with eye sensor technology for automatic activation and comfortable composition.

With a tilting 3-inch LCD touchscreen, it facilitates flexible shooting angles and intuitive menu navigation. The camera supports Wi-Fi connectivity for quick image sharing and remote control via compatible devices.

The compact and robust magnesium alloy body design incorporates weather resistance to ensure durability during various shooting conditions.

Key Advantages

The Panasonic Lumix GX9 offers excellent image quality through its 20.3MP Micro Four Thirds sensor, ideal for high-resolution photography.

Its 5-axis Dual I.S. 2 stabilization provides unmatched image steadiness for both photos and videos.

Compact and lightweight body design enhances portability without sacrificing build quality.

The tilting touchscreen simplifies composition from different angles, beneficial for creative photography.

4K video recording capabilities expand creative options for videographers.

Wi-Fi connectivity enables easy image transfer and remote shooting, improving workflow efficiency.

Limitations

The Micro Four Thirds sensor, while versatile, has smaller size compared to APS-C or full-frame sensors, restricting low-light performance.

The camera lacks built-in flash, requiring external flash units for additional lighting.

The buffer capacity for continuous shooting is moderate, limiting burst shooting times under certain conditions.

The absence of a fully articulating screen may limit usability for vlogging or selfies.

Battery life is average, requiring spares for extensive shooting sessions.

No built-in GPS, so geotagging depends on external devices or manual input.
